Sgt. Michael van Buren is Named Flagler County Deputy of the Year for 2nd Time

Sgt. van Buren was cited for saving a 4-year-old child from a locked car in July heat and controlling and averting a suicide-by cop with an armed woman in Palm Coast in September.

Gov. Scott and Florida Cabinet Honor 3 From Flagler: John Seth, Rick Staly and Ed Wolff

Rick Staly until spring was the undersheriff in the Jim Manfre administration, John Seth is the long-time band director at Flagler Palm Coast High School, and Ed Wolff is the county’s teacher of the year.

A 2-Year-Old’s Life Saved and a Murder Suspect’s Arrest Headline Sheriff’s 3rd Quarter Awards

Communications Supervisor Genice Caccavale was one of three department employees to win Employee of the Quarter awards, Sheriff Jim Manfre announced this week. Also winning were Detective Mark Moy and Detention Deputy Randy Vickers.

Abigail Lemay, NOW and ACLU Activist at Stetson, Wins National Undergraduate Social Action Award

Lemay re-founded Stetson’s chapter of the National Organization for Women and the university’s American Civil Liberties Union chapter, and produced Even Ensler’s “Vagina Monologues” in 2010 and 2011 .

Bob Pickering, Flagler Voice of Climate Safety, Wins National Weather Association Award

Bob Pickering, for 17 years a technician in Flagler County’s Emergency Management, won the national award from the National Weather Association for bridging weather forecasting with public safety.

Obama’s Nobel Lecture: “Bend History”

In his Nobel peace prize lecture, Barack Obama evoked the notions of just wars to counter the irony of being “the Commander-in-Chief of the military of a nation in the midst of two wars.”
